A litre is a metric unit of volume equal to 1,000 cubic centimeters, while a quart is an imperial unit equal to a quarter gallon. Qt) is a unit of volume in the united states customary and imperial systems of measurement. In practical terms, a liter provides a slightly larger volume than a us quart, making it noticeable in cooking and filling containers. Liter πŸ‘‰ discover the slight size difference between a. In the us, a liquid quart is equal to approximately 0.946353 liters and a dry quart is equal to approximately 1.101221 liters. A litre is a metric unit of volume equal to 1,000 cubic centimeters, used worldwide, while a quart is an imperial unit of volume, smaller than a litre, used primarily in the u.s.
